Improving Warehouse Ventilation for Productivity

In the bustling realm of warehouse operations, maintaining a healthy and productive environment is paramount. Adequate ventilation plays a crucial role in this endeavor, ensuring worker comfort and safety while optimizing operational efficiency. By implementing best practices for warehouse ventilation, facility managers can create a workplace where employees thrive and productivity soars.

One fundamental aspect of effective warehouse ventilation involves identifying potential sources of airborne pollutants. These may include dust generated by material handling, fumes emitted from machinery, or volatile organic compounds (VOCs) released from cleaning products. Thoroughly assessing these sources allows for the development of a targeted ventilation strategy.

A well-designed warehouse ventilation system should incorporate a mixture of mechanical and natural methods. Mechanical ventilation systems, such as exhaust fans and air purifiers, actively remove contaminants from the air. Meanwhile, natural ventilation techniques, like strategically placed windows and vents, leverage airflow patterns to facilitate fresh air circulation.

By adhering to these best practices, warehouse managers can create a safe environment that fosters employee well-being, reduces the risk of respiratory problems, and promotes overall productivity.
